Key Trends in the Wind and Solar Hybrid Monitoring Systems Market

The market is shaped by several key trends, including:

1. Technological Advancements: Innovations in monitoring technologies, such as AI-driven analytics, IoT-enabled devices, and advanced sensors, are revolutionizing hybrid system operations. These advancements improve energy efficiency, predictive maintenance, and overall system reliability.

2. Policy Support: Governments worldwide are promoting renewable energy adoption through subsidies, tax incentives, and regulations. This support encourages the implementation of hybrid monitoring systems, particularly in regions with aggressive renewable energy targets.

Opportunities in the Wind and Solar Hybrid Monitoring Systems Market

1. Growing Demand in Emerging Economies: Developing countries present significant opportunities for market growth due to increasing energy demands, inadequate power infrastructure, and a rising focus on sustainability. Hybrid systems are seen as viable solutions to address these challenges.

2. Expansion of Off-Grid Solutions: The increasing need for reliable energy in remote areas creates opportunities for off-grid hybrid monitoring systems. These solutions address energy access challenges while promoting environmental sustainability.
